Why AirPlay and Screen Mirroring Fail with IPTV Content
Screen mirroring and AirPlay issues plague IPTV users trying to cast content from their iPhone or iPad to Apple TV. These casting problems stem from several technical limitations that make wireless streaming unreliable for IPTV content.
IPTV streams require consistent bandwidth and low latency. When you add the overhead of AirPlay compression and wireless transmission, you're essentially streaming a stream—creating a double bottleneck that leads to buffering, quality degradation, and sync issues.
Most IPTV apps on iOS weren't designed with AirPlay optimization in mind. They prioritize direct playback over casting compatibility, leaving users frustrated when their favorite shows won't mirror properly to the big screen.
Common IPTV Casting Problems and Quick Fixes
Audio and Video Out of Sync
Audio delay during AirPlay is common with IPTV content due to compression lag. Try these solutions:
- Close other apps consuming bandwidth
- Move closer to your Wi-Fi router
- Restart both your iOS device and Apple TV
- Switch to 5GHz Wi-Fi if available
Stuttering and Buffering During Mirroring
Screen mirroring doubles your bandwidth usage—once for the IPTV stream and again for the cast. To reduce stuttering:
- Lower your IPTV stream quality before mirroring
- Ensure no other devices are using heavy bandwidth
- Use wired ethernet on your Apple TV if possible
- Try mirroring during off-peak internet hours
Black Screen or No Video During AirPlay
Some IPTV content includes DRM or copy protection that blocks casting:
- Check if the issue occurs with all content or specific channels
- Try casting different types of content (live TV vs on-demand)
- Verify your IPTV provider supports casting
- Update both iOS and tvOS to the latest versions
Network Troubleshooting for Better IPTV Casting
Your network setup significantly impacts casting performance. IPTV screen mirroring requires robust Wi-Fi coverage and sufficient bandwidth.
Position your router centrally between your iOS device, Apple TV, and internet connection. Avoid casting during peak usage when multiple household members stream simultaneously.
Consider upgrading to Wi-Fi 6 or Wi-Fi 6E if you frequently cast IPTV content. These newer standards handle multiple high-bandwidth streams more efficiently than older Wi-Fi protocols.
Optimal Network Settings
- Use 5GHz Wi-Fi for both devices when possible
- Enable Quality of Service (QoS) prioritization for streaming
- Maintain at least 25 Mbps for 4K casting
- Keep devices within 30 feet of your router

The Native Apple TV IPTV App Advantage
Native Apple TV IPTV apps eliminate casting problems entirely by running directly on your television. Instead of streaming from your phone to your TV, the app accesses your IPTV service directly from Apple TV.
This approach provides several benefits over screen mirroring:
- No wireless transmission lag or quality loss
- Your iPhone or iPad remains free for other tasks
- Better integration with Apple TV's interface and remote
- Optimized performance for television viewing
- No battery drain on your mobile device
Modern IPTV players for Apple TV also offer features impossible through casting, like MultiView for watching multiple channels simultaneously and advanced EPG integration.
